"Name of the mini-opera composed by Gershwin for George White's Scandals?

A) Porgy and Bess
B) Rhapsody in Blue
C) Blue Monday
D) Of Thee I Sing"

Final answer:

The mini-opera composed by Gershwin for 'George White's Scandals' is known as 'Blue Monday.' The correct option is C.

Step-by-step explanation:

The name of the mini-opera composed by George Gershwin for George White's Scandals is Blue Monday. This 1922 composition is sometimes referred to as the "135th Street" mini-opera and is an early example of Gershwin blending classical music with jazz influences.

While Porgy and Bess is perhaps Gershwin's most famous opera and Rhapsody in Blue is one of his well-known compositions, neither of these is the correct answer.

Of Thee I Sing is a musical with scores by Gershwin but is not an opera. Therefore, the correct selection from the given options is C) Blue Monday.
